PMMD: A pose-guided multi-view multi-modal diffusion for person generation

生成具有可控姿态和外观的一致人像,在虚拟试衣、图像编辑和数字人创建中至关重要。现有方法常面临遮挡、服装风格漂移和姿态对齐偏差问题。本文提出姿态引导的多视角多模态扩散模型(PMMD),通过多视图参考、姿态图和文本提示生成逼真人像。设计多模态编码器联合建模视觉视角、姿态特征与语义描述,降低跨模态差异,提升身份保真度;引入ResCVA模块增强局部细节并保持全局结构;设计跨模态融合模块,在去噪过程中整合图像语义与文本信息。在DeepFashion MultiModal数据集上的实验表明,PMMD在一致性、细节保留和可控性方面优于代表性基线方法。项目主页与代码见https://github.com/ZANMANGLOOPYE/PMMD。

原文摘要 · Abstract (English)

Generating consistent human images with controllable pose and appearance is essential for applications in virtual try on, image editing, and digital human creation. Current methods often suffer from occlusions, garment style drift, and pose misalignment. We propose Pose-guided Multi-view Multimodal Diffusion (PMMD), a diffusion framework that synthesizes photorealistic person images conditioned on multi-view references, pose maps, and text prompts. A multimodal encoder jointly models visual views, pose features, and semantic descriptions, which reduces cross modal discrepancy and improves identity fidelity. We further design a ResCVA module to enhance local detail while preserving global structure, and a cross modal fusion module that integrates image semantics with text throughout the denoising pipeline. Experiments on the DeepFashion MultiModal dataset show that PMMD outperforms representative baselines in consistency, detail preservation, and controllability. Project page and code are available at https://github.com/ZANMANGLOOPYE/PMMD.
